Section courante

A propos

Section administrative du site

 Système d'exploitation  Utilisation  Tutoriel  Annexe  Aide 
Amiga
Apple
CP/M / DOS
CoCo
Cray
Mainframe
Mobile
OS/2
TRS-80
UNIX
Windows
Autres
AmigaDOS
AmigaOS
MorphOS
Apple DOS
System 1.0
System 1.1
System 2.0
System 3.0
System 3.1
System 3.2
System 3.3
System 4.0
System 4.1
System 4.2
System 4.3
System 6.0
System 7.0
System 7.1
System 7.5
System 7.6
Mac OS 8.0
Mac OS 8.1
Mac OS 8.5
Mac OS 8.6
Mac OS 9.0
Mac OS 9.1
Mac OS 9.2
Mac OS X
Mac OS X Server
Apple DOS
Caldera DR-DOS 7
CP/M
CP/M-80
CP/M-86
DOS
DR-DOS
FreeDOS
IBM DOS 4
IBM DOS 5
MS-DOS
PC DOS
PTS-DOS
DR-DOS 5
DR-DOS 6
DR-DOS 7
MS-DOS 1.25
MS-DOS 2.0
MS-DOS 2.11
MS-DOS 3.0
MS-DOS 3.20
MS-DOS 3.21
MS-DOS 3.3
MS-DOS 4
MS-DOS 5
MS-DOS 6
MS-DOS 6.2
MS-DOS 7.10
PC DOS 1.0
PC DOS 1.1
PC DOS 2.0
PC DOS 2.1
PC DOS 3.0
PC DOS 3.1
PC DOS 3.2
PC DOS 3.3
PC DOS 4.0
PC DOS 4.01
PC DOS 5.0
PC DOS 6.1
PC DOS 6.3
PC DOS 7.0
PC DOS 2000
FLEX
OS-9
COS
UNICOS
OpenVMS
OS/390
OS/400
VAX/VMS
z/OS
Android OS
Bada
EPOC
PalmOS
Citrix Multiuser
eComStation
OS/2 Version 1
OS/2 Version 1.1
OS/2 Version 1.2
OS/2 Version 1.3
OS/2 Version 2
OS/2 Version 2.1
OS/2 Warp 3
OS/2 Warp 4
LDOS
MultiDOS
NEWDOS
TRSDOS
AIX
FreeBSD
HP-UX
Linux
QNX
SkyOS
Solaris (SunOS)
UNIX
XENIX
ReactOS
Windows 95
Windows 98
Windows Me
Windows NT 4.0 Server
Windows 2000 Professionnel
Windows 2000 Server
Windows XP
Windows Server 2003
Windows Server 2003 R2
Windows Server 2008
Windows Server 2008 R2
Windows Server 2012
Windows Server 2012 R2
Windows Server 2016
Windows Server 2019
Windows Vista
Windows 7
Windows 8
Windows 10
Windows 11
FLEX
KolibriOS
Inferno
Medos-2
Oberon
Plan 9
p-System
RDOS
Introduction
Références des commandes
Références de pilotes
Les premiers pas
Procédure de démarrage
Procédure de copie de sauvegarde
Procédures de disque et de partition de travail
Fonctionnalités de commande
Fonctionnalités de démarrage
Fonctionnalités du répertoire
Fonctionnalités d'entrée/sortie
Fonctionnalités des composantes du système
Sommaire des commandes
Structure de données
Format de fichiers
FCB (File Control Block)
PSP (Prefix Segment Program)
CONFIG.SYS
.BAT
.COM
.EXE
Liste des exécutables populaires (.EXE)
Préface
Notes légal
Dictionnaire
Recherche

TIME

Heure
Zenith Data Systems Microsoft MS-DOS 2 Interne

Syntaxe

TIME
TIME hh[:mm[:ss[.cc]]]

Paramètres

Nom Description
hh Ce paramètre permet d'indiquer une valeur comprise entre 00 et 23, désignant l'heure.
mm Ce paramètre permet d'indiquer une valeur comprise entre 00 et 59, désignant la minute.
ss Ce paramètre permet d'indiquer une valeur comprise entre 00 et 59, désignant la seconde.
cc Ce paramètre permet d'indiquer une valeur comprise entre 00 et 59, désignant le centième de seconde.

Description

Cette commande permet de fixer ou de demander l'heure du système d'exploitation.

Remarque

Concepts préliminaires

L'heure affichée et/ou spécifiée avec la commande TIME est utilisée par le système dans les fonctions "housekeeping" de tous les niveaux de répertoire. L'heure est enregistrée dans le répertoire pour tous les fichiers créés ou modifiés, permettant à l'utilisateur de garder une trace des fichiers en cours. La commande TIME peut être appelée à partir du système vous demandant l'entrée requise ; ou une entrée de ligne de commande, dans laquelle vous entrez les paramètres requis lorsque vous appelez la commande.

À l'aide de TIME et DATE, le système conserve une horloge interne et un calendrier précis tant que le système fonctionne. Le MS-DOS met correctement à jour l'heure et la date lorsque les valeurs changent au cours de n'importe quelle session de travail. (L'heure est mise à jour en continu, car l'horloge système maintient l'heure précise au centième de seconde.) L'heure est utilisée par le système pour reporter la date. Si le système est laissé allumé pendant un certain temps, la date sera correcte, même si un nouveau mois ou une nouvelle année commence pendant la session de travail.

Remarque : Lorsque vous utilisez un fichier AUTOEXEC.BAT, le MS-DOS ne vous demandera pas l'heure (et/ou la date) à moins que vous n'ayez inclus la commande TIME (et/ou DATE) dans le fichier AUTOEXEC.BAT.

Prompt de saisie interactive et réponse

Si vous entrez TIME et appuyez sur RETURN sans fournir de paramètres, le système vous demande :

Current time is hh:mm:ss.cc
Enter new time:

Dans cet affichage, l'heure est indiquée en heures, minutes, secondes et centièmes de seconde.

Si vous ne souhaitez pas modifier l'heure affichée, appuyez sur RETURN. Le système ne changera pas le temps qu'il utilise. Après avoir appuyé sur RETURN, le prompt du système s'affiche.

Si vous souhaitez modifier l'heure affichée (c'est-à-dire régler l'horloge système sur l'heure actuelle), saisissez l'heure et appuyez sur RETURN. Notez que l'heure que vous entrez doit être au format 24 heures et que vous n'êtes pas obligé d'entrer des valeurs pour les secondes ou les centièmes de seconde.

Les valeurs de paramètre autorisées pour l'heure que vous entrez sont :

Nom Description
hh Ce paramètre permet d'indiquer une valeur de 00 à 23 désignant l'heure.
mm Ce paramètre permet d'indiquer une valeur de 00 à 59 désignant la minute.
ss Ce paramètre permet d'indiquer une valeur de 00 à 59, désignant la seconde.
cc Ce paramètre permet d'indiquer une valeur de 00 à 99, désignant le centième de seconde.

Remarque : L'heure affichée par le système et acceptée avec la commande TIME est au format 24 heures. Ainsi, si vous vouliez spécifier 2:00 PM, vous entreriez 14:00 ou 14. Notez également que vous n'êtes pas obligé d'entrer des valeurs pour les secondes ou les centièmes de seconde. Si vous entrez une valeur pour l'heure et que vous ne spécifiez pas de valeurs pour les paramètres de centième de seconde, de seconde ou de minute, la valeur de chacun de ces paramètres est supposée être 00.

Seules des valeurs numériques peuvent être saisies ; les lettres ne sont pas autorisées. Les paramètres heure, minute et seconde doivent être séparés par deux-points (:). Les paramètres seconde et centième de seconde doivent être séparés par un point (.). Aucun autre séparateur n'est valide.

Le MS-DOS accepte toutes les saisies tant que les paramètres et les séparateurs que vous utilisez sont valides. Si une valeur de paramètre invalide de séparateur est saisie, l'heure saisie est ignorée et le système demande :

Invalid time:
Enter new time:

Vous pouvez ensuite saisir à nouveau l'heure correcte ou appuyer sur RETURN pour utiliser l'heure préexistante.

Entrée de ligne de commande

Si vous appelez la commande TIME en entrant «TIME hh[:mm[:ss[.cc]]]» au prompt du système et en appuyant sur RETURN, le système règle son horloge sur l'heure que vous avez entrée sans afficher l'heure préexistante ou vous invitant à entrer l'heure. Une fois la commande exécutée, le prompt système s'affiche à nouveau.

Les valeurs de paramètre autorisées pour l'heure que vous entrez sont :

Nom Description
hh Ce paramètre permet d'indiquer une valeur de 00 à 23 désignant l'heure.
mm Ce paramètre permet d'indiquer une valeur de 00 à 59 désignant la minute.
ss Ce paramètre permet d'indiquer une valeur de 00 à 59, désignant la seconde.
cc Ce paramètre permet d'indiquer une valeur de 00 à 99, désignant le centième de seconde.

Remarque : L'heure affichée par le système et acceptée avec la commande TIME est au format 24 heures. Ainsi, si vous vouliez spécifier 14:00, vous entreriez 14:00 ou 14. Notez également que vous n'êtes pas obligé d'entrer des valeurs pour les secondes ou les centièmes de seconde. Si vous entrez une valeur pour l'heure et que vous ne spécifiez pas de valeurs pour les paramètres de centième de seconde, de seconde ou de minute, la valeur de chacun de ces paramètres est supposée être 00.

Seules des valeurs numériques peuvent être saisies ; les lettres ne sont pas autorisées. Les paramètres heure, minute et seconde doivent être séparés par deux-points (:). Les paramètres secondes et centièmes de seconde doivent être séparés par un point (.). Aucun autre séparateur n'est valide.

Usage

Comme la commande DATE, la commande TIME vous aide à garder une trace des fichiers à des fins d'archivage. Il définit l'heure de création/modification en séquences plus petites que DATE. (DATE vous donne la date de création ; TIME vous donne l'heure de la journée à laquelle le fichier a été créé.) Cela peut vous aider à distinguer un fichier d'un autre si vous avez travaillé toute la journée à développer une série de fichiers pour un programme. En fin de compte, vous pouvez avoir plusieurs copies de développement de vos fichiers sur plusieurs disques. L'heure enregistrée dans le répertoire pour chaque fichier, ainsi que la date, vous donne une référence claire à la devise du fichier.

Vous pouvez également utiliser la commande TIME pour vous aider à savoir combien de temps vous travaillez sur un projet donné. Pour mesurer le temps écoulé pendant une session de travail, vous pouvez entrer TIME 00 ou TIME 0 au début de la session pour régler le temps à "0". Ensuite, à la fin de votre session, vous pourriez simplement entrer TIME sans paramètre, et le temps affiché serait le temps écoulé.

Message d'erreur

Invalid time
Enter new time:

Explication : Vous avez saisi une heure invalide. Vous avez peut-être saisi trop ou trop peu d'informations, une valeur de paramètre non valide ou utilisé des séparateurs non valides. Rentrer l'heure.



PARTAGER CETTE PAGE SUR
Dernière mise à jour : Mercredi, le 24 Août 2022